## Break-Glass: Log Sampling Overrides (Murkfeed Service)

Murkfeed emits ~2M lines/min. Default sampling is 1:500. Plugin authors must not disable sampling globally. Break-glass applies only when a plugin incident requires full-fidelity logs for one tenant, max 30 minutes. Steps: set the tenant override in the Brackwell console, start the auto-revert timer, file an incident note. Overrides without a timer get killed by the janitor job. Access to the override console is sealed; unseal it with the recovery passphrase below.

recovery phrase for fajep-yaweg: gilath-sorox-wenius-rusdor-keliel-zorius

## Tuning

The Saltmere tide-table widget polls the upstream prediction feed and caches results locally, so most support issues trace back to poll frequency or cache staleness rather than the feed itself. Before escalating, check that the customer hasn't overridden the defaults, since aggressive polling can trip the feed's rate limiter and show stale tides. All tunable behavior lives in one configuration block, and the shipped defaults are listed below.

tuning constants:
BUDGETS = {
    "druath": 240,
    "lamwyn": 180,
    "silael": 275,
}

Subject: Heads-up on spreadsheet export memory spikes

Hi, welcome aboard. One thing you'll hit on-call: the Ledgerloom export service loads entire workbooks into memory, so exports over ~200k rows can spike a worker past its limit and trigger restarts. If you see repeated OOM kills on the export pool, check the queue for oversized jobs and split them. The mitigation steps and sizing guidance are here:

operations page: https://confluence.tolvaqsys.corp/spaces/pages/pages/6e787158f507

This PR reworks the Tallbridge fleet fuel-usage report to aggregate per-depot rather than per-vehicle, fixing the double-counting seen in the Ashgrove rollout. All figures were cross-checked against last quarter's manual audit. Please review the smoothing and outlier thresholds carefully, as they directly affect the published numbers.

constants for fawep-yagap:
QUOTAS = {
    "noveth": 275,
    "oliion": 740,
}